One thing to keep in mind if doing a mod like this...
The leg/fork/wheel/tire/ work as an assembly.
Changing one will effect others.
Adding a larger fork for a larger wheel makes a larger bending moment of the wheel load on the gear leg (because the axle center is further away from the pivot point of the fork). This could cause the leg to have an even higher tendency to bend.
